The nrf51822 chip is still widely available, for example in the BBC micro:bit. Therefore it's a good idea to support it too. Unfortunately, Nordic decided to change the API in some significant ways so many parts are not compatible between S110 for nrf51 and the other nrf52* SoftDevices.
